Triple H’s recent booking decision was criticized by a former WWE employee.

Triple H has come under a lot of scrutiny over the past few months for many of his booking decisions. Many fans have criticized the WWE product for being too boring. There was even some speculation that WWE was using AI to write some of the storylines. This week on WWE RAW, Triple H came under scrutiny again.

This week on the red brand, the first round matches of the King and Queen of the Ring tournament kicked off. The winner of each tournament would receive a World Title shot at SummerSlam. However, something strange about the Queen of the Ring tournament quickly became evident. Liv Morgan, who is the current Women’s World Champion, was also added to the tournament along with Roxanne Perez and Raquel Rodriguez. This made no sense since Liv was already a World Champion and didn’t need to be in this tournament.

Tommy Carlucci questioned Triple H for adding Liv Morgan to the Queen of the Ring tournament

Speaking on the latest edition of Behind The Turnbuckle Studios’ The Last Word, Tommy Carlucci said that it made no sense to add Liv Morgan to the Queen of the Ring tournament when several other women on the roster could’ve benefited from the opportunity. He also said that he wants to see Chelsea Green win Queen of the Ring this year.

“It makes no sense. No sense to put your champ in a Queen of the Ring when that person who wins Queen of the Ring gets to have a title shot against the champ. And who’s the champ? Liv Morgan. Put Maxxine Dupri. She was complaining tonight. Throw her in. Can we at least give Chelsea Green a chance because I wanna see her win? Originally, I thought Lash was gonna win today. I thought she was gonna go all the way and then have a title match at SummerSlam. I thought they were building her that way. I guess not because… And I don’t mind IYO winning either, but it makes zero sense, creative guys. Whoever’s doing this writing, why? My question would be to Triple H. Why would you put the champ who the winner of the Queen of the Ring faces the champ, why would you put the champ in Queen of the Ring? Can you answer me that? And you have a million other women not in it. Is Bailey in it? I don’t think she’s in it. Yeah she is. That’s right. Okay. We can face each other. I wanna see Chelsea win.”

It remains to be seen if Liv Morgan will win Queen of the Ring this year.
